[devel] Re: patch-2.5.9

Dmitry V. Levin =?iso-8859-1?q?ldv_=CE=C1_altlinux=2Eorg?=
Ср Окт 26 16:36:15 MSD 2005


On Wed, Oct 26, 2005 at 10:43:21AM +0400, Mikhail Zabaluev wrote:
> В Срд, 26/10/2005 в 01:56 +0400, Dmitry V. Levin пишет:
> > > > > > > - Один из патчей каким-то образом приобрел окончания строк вида CRLF,
> > > > > > > что не понравилось patch 2.5.9 (2ldv: кстати, как там приемка?).
> > > > > > 
> > > > > > В очереди стоит.  А что, patch-2.5.9 более привередливый, чем 2.5.4?
> > > > > 
> > > > > Судя по тому, что mozilla из Sisyphus у меня не собирается, да.
> > > > 
> > > > Это плохо, придётся фиксить.
> > > 
> > > patch или патчи?
> > 
> > patch, конечно.
> 
> По-моему, патчи с CRLF, когда в исходных строках LF, должны быть
> нелегальны, т.к создают неоднозначность в допустимых исходных файлах, и
> непонятно, какие концы строк должны быть в результате.

Иногда понятно.

> Иначе почему 2.5.9 стал такой привередливый?

По ошибке.
Иначе почему тогда понадобилось патчить 2.5.9?

2003-07-02  Paul Eggert  <eggert@>

        * pch.c (intuit_diff_type): If a unified-diff header line contains
        trailing CR, strip CR from each body line.  This corrects a bug
        introduced in the 2003-05-18 patch.  Bug reported by Andreas
        Gruenbacher.


-- 
ldv
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ип     : application/pgp-signature
Размер  : 189 байтов
Описание: =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20051026/efbfeb0e/attachment-0001.bin>


Подробная информация о списке рассылки Devel